Learn More About Cook Jobs

How much does a Cook earn in Mandan, ND?

The average cook in Mandan, ND earns between $23,000 and $37,000 annually. This compares to the national average cook range of $25,000 to $40,000.

Average Cook Salary In Mandan, ND

$29,000
